Decoding the Typical Big Brother Airing Schedule
So, what's the deal? When can you expect to get your weekly dose of Big Brother drama, strategic gameplay, and houseguest antics? The Big Brother schedule has gone through some changes over the years, but typically, you can count on seeing new episodes multiple times a week. The most common schedule involves episodes airing on Sundays, Wednesdays, and Thursdays. However, be prepared for the occasional shift due to holidays, special events, or other programming on the network. Generally, the Sunday episodes often feature the Head of Household (HOH) competition and nominations for eviction, setting the stage for the week's drama. Wednesday episodes typically highlight the Power of Veto (POV) competition and the aftermath, where the winner can choose to save a nominee, potentially shaking up the entire game. And Thursday nights are usually reserved for the nail-biting live eviction shows where one houseguest's game ends, and we find out who the new HOH is. This structure keeps the momentum going throughout the week, giving viewers plenty of opportunities to see all the alliances form and crumble! Remember, this is the general framework, and the specific times and days can vary, so always consult your local listings for the most accurate information. Furthermore, Big Brother often has themed weeks or special episodes that may alter the typical schedule. Keep an eye out for these twists, as they can change the game's trajectory. For example, a double eviction night, when two houseguests are sent home in one night, is always a guaranteed source of excitement.

Special Episodes and Schedule Variations
Be prepared for the Big Brother schedule to occasionally deviate from the usual routine. Reality TV is nothing if not unpredictable! Several factors can influence the airing schedule: — Asia Cup Final: The Ultimate Showdown
- Holidays: Expect schedule changes during holidays like the Fourth of July, Memorial Day, or Labor Day. Networks often adjust their programming to accommodate holiday-related events. Keep an eye on the listings for any special airings or pre-emptions during holiday periods.
- Sports: Major sporting events like the Olympics or professional sports championships can also lead to schedule shifts. Networks may prioritize sports programming over regular shows, including Big Brother. Again, check the TV listings for any changes.
- Double Eviction Nights: These exciting episodes see two houseguests evicted in a single night, leading to an extended episode. They are often broadcast on Thursday nights. Always be aware of the possibility of double eviction nights, as they can significantly alter the schedule for that week.
- Twists and Special Events: Big Brother is famous for its twists and special events. These may require additional airtime or affect the episode schedule. Some examples include extended competitions, live feeds, or special themed weeks. Check for announcements from the show.
- Live Shows: Live shows, particularly the eviction episodes, are susceptible to time adjustments based on the length of the events. Delays are possible, so check the real-time listing if you plan on watching live.
